Output 1970312815dd66bdd98e76753ac24556bcb2aec67ba38e9692081b88d9d4eec9:3
- value
- 1375982744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f7f02b3f17fa94b2626dd82c6f15b5b0a54c877 OP_EQUAL
- address
- 3629qQd2fagrUSqqEnYbX7Hk6qhZ9eZrqA
- transaction
- 1970312815dd66bdd98e76753ac24556bcb2aec67ba38e9692081b88d9d4eec9